Andreas Westphal is a wayside cross in Simmerath, Aachen, North Rhine-Westphalia. Andreas Westphal is situated nearby to the scenic viewpoint Eifelblick Simmerath ‘Schöne Aussicht’, as well as near the community center Bürgerhaus.Places of Interest Nearby
